Ordered my first AR!!

Just finished the order online a couple of hours ago through Grab A Gun for my first AR 15.

I vacillated between Springfield's Saint, Ruger's AR 556, Smith's M&P 15, and Savage's MSR 15 Recon. The Ruger and Smith were below $500. The Savage was $768, and the Saint was $799.

I liked the specs on the Savage and the Saint the best. That's probably why they were the most $$$.

Anyways, I went with the Savage MSR 15 Recon as my first AR. Hopefully, Grab A Gun will send me an email to come pick it up in a couple of days. I live within 35 miles of their store. Now to stock up on magazines and ammo.

I bought a Ruger AR556 from Grab-A-Gun a few weeks ago.
That $475 price tag got me.
This is my 3rd AR platform rifle.
I added a Bushnell TRS25 Hi Mount red dot to it.
I took it to the range in Texas City and zeroed the open sights first at 50 yds.
Once that was done, I zeroed the red dot and then just shot it for fun for a total of about 250 rounds that first outing.
I had just as much enjoyment from shooting that $475 rifle as I would from shooting a high dollar custom built one.
